What is LV and HV?
Extra low voltage (ELV) means voltage of 50V or less (AC RMS), or 120V or less (ripple-free DC). Low voltage (LV) means voltage greater than ELV, but not more than 1000V (AC RMS) or 1500V (ripple-free DC). High voltage (HV) means voltage greater than low voltage.
What voltage is HV?
Definition
| IEC voltage range | AC RMS voltage (V) | DC voltage (V) |
|---|---|---|
| High voltage | > 1 000 | > 1 500 |
| Low voltage | 50 to 1 000 | 120 to 1 500 |
| Extra-low voltage | < 50 | < 120 |

What happens when current is increased?
If current increases in a conductor there will be increased voltage drop in electrical conductors so there will be less voltage at the load. The increase in current will cause an increase in voltage loss across the cells of the battery and therefore there will be a little voltage less at the terminals.
Why current can kill us?
At low currents, AC electricity can disrupt the nerve signals from the natural pacemaker in your heart and cause fibrillation. The highest currents (more than one amp) cause burns through resistive heating as the current passes through the body. If this path crosses the heart or brain, then the burn may be fatal.
